Arancini in an air fryer

Arancini in an air fryer

If you've tried Sicilian arancini at a restaurant, you know how delicious they are. In this recipe, risotto balls are rolled in breadcrumbs with Italian herbs and fried in an air fryer until wonderfully crispy. It's an easier alternative to classic arancini. Inside each ball, there's a surprise: melting, gooey mozzarella. It's recommended to prepare the risotto for the arancini the night before so it can set well in the refrigerator overnight, making it easier to shape the balls.

Fried chicken in an air fryer

Fried chicken in an air fryer

Crispy fried chicken from an air fryer is a truly delightful discovery. You can cook it with an incredibly crispy skin without the need for excess fat or deep-frying. Before frying, soak the chicken in spiced sour milk for several hours (or better yet, overnight) to ensure the meat is delicious and juicy inside. Due to the size of the air fryer, you'll have to fry the chicken in several batches, but you can easily reheat the first batch in the oven for 10 minutes and serve it all at once.



Fried Oreos in an Air Fryer

Fried Oreos in an Air Fryer

Oreo cookies are so popular in the United States that they're not only eaten plain but also used in a variety of other desserts. One such dessert is deep-fried Oreos. These are cookies coated in a crispy batter and are typically found at fairs and street festivals. This recipe uses a thick pancake batter instead of deep-frying. It should be thick enough to cover the cookies, so adjust the consistency as needed. A few minutes in the air fryer, and you'll have a wonderfully soft Oreo-filled cake. Dust with powdered sugar and serve.



Fried shrimp in an air fryer

Fried shrimp in an air fryer

Air fryering makes your breaded shrimp as delicious and crispy as deep-fried shrimp, but without the extra oil, fat, and calories. Use large peeled shrimp with tails on. Each shrimp is dredged in seasoned flour, then in egg, and coated with coarse, fluffy panko breadcrumbs. After frying, the shrimp are crispy on the outside and tender and juicy on the inside. Serve with spicy remoulade or any other sauce of your choice. A perfect appetizer for house parties or movie night.



Potato flowers in an air fryer

Potato flowers in an air fryer

These charming flower-shaped potatoes, made with an apple slicer and a watermelon scoop, are a hit with both kids and adults. Roast them whole in the air fryer until tender inside and crispy on the outside. For this recipe, we recommend choosing potatoes of uniform size, at least 3 cm wide. Once the potato flowers are removed from the air fryer, garnish each with ranch dressing and half a cherry tomato. Or add another dipping sauce of your choice, such as hummus or guacamole.

Potato chips in an air fryer

Potato chips in an air fryer

Delicious, crispy potato chips can be easily made in an air fryer, using just one tablespoon of oil. A mandoline slicer allows you to quickly slice potatoes into paper-thin circles. To ensure crispy chips that don't stick together during frying, be sure to rinse the potatoes thoroughly, removing all the starch. This is an important step; don't skip it!

Spicy Pork Belly and Kabocha Squash in the Air Fryer

Spicy Pork Belly and Kabocha Squash in the Air Fryer

In Korea, there are many recipes for the country's beloved pork belly, which is grilled whole, cooked on the stovetop, or baked in the oven. Air fryers are also becoming increasingly popular. This device is convenient for light, spatter-free frying. The pork belly turns out crispy and seared on the outside, while the inside remains tender and juicy. A few minutes before it's ready, brush it with spicy gochujang sauce, which will caramelize on the surface and turn into a delicious glaze. Cook kabocha squash in the air fryer along with the pork belly and serve with rice.

Pork ribs in an air fryer

Pork ribs in an air fryer

An air fryer will help you cook spare ribs quickly and easily on a weekday. Separate the ribs into individual bones, and they'll fit into the air fryer, cook quickly, and develop an even, crispy crust all over. After frying, be sure to coat them with warm barbecue sauce. While still hot, they'll absorb more aroma and flavor.

Steak in an air fryer with butter, garlic and herbs

Steak in an air fryer with butter, garlic and herbs

Great news: you can cook a delicious beef steak in an air fryer! Large, thick cuts of steak, like sirloin steak, are best—they'll develop a nice crust on the outside without overcooking the inside. Follow the cooking time specified in the recipe to ensure the steak reaches your desired doneness. To serve, prepare a fragrant butter with garlic and fresh herbs. Spoon it over the hot steak, let it melt, and enjoy!



Airfryer tacos for breakfast

Airfryer tacos for breakfast

This unique recipe uses silicone ice cube trays, shaped like ice cube sticks, to quickly prepare breakfast taco ingredients in the air fryer. In one tray, tortillas will bake into crispy taco pockets. In the other tray, beaten eggs will bake simultaneously with the tortillas. Remove the cooked eggs from the tray and place them into the cheesy taco pockets. Add some spicy mayo, tomato, and avocado for a deliciously crispy breakfast treat.
